PSEFI-SKILLS' Tech-Voc Caravan Around Cebu Province

Alcoy Oslob We have been visiting Cebu province's municipalities since August this year to drum up a support campaign for our local government units in the province to embark on technical-vocational training for their constituents. This, aside from the courtesy visits we need to make to all the newly-elected government officials, specifically the municipalities' mayors and vice-mayors. Boljoon Carcar City It was good to be introduced to different places in the province and to take a peek at their town's concerns that need focused attention: drug rehabilitation and life skills training for their drug surrenderees, water problem, housing, infrastructure development, trade and livelihood, disaster preparedness, and more! Our city and municipal mayors really need all the support they can from private organizations they can partner with in order to help them fund their various programs for their people. Community Clean-Up Drive at Minglanilla and Naga City, Cebu: A PSEFI Partnership With PSC's Manufacturing Department

PSEFI-SKILLS' staff had an enriching morning two Saturdays ago, May 7, 2016, along with the members of Primary Structures Corporation's (PSC) Manufacturing Department (MD) who organized this community clean-up drive, the second corporate social responsibility (CSR) initiative for this year. The destination for this CSR was the riverside of Guindaruhan, Minglanilla, Cebu and Cantao-an, Naga City, Cebu. PSC's MD was led by Mr. Rene Verano, Jerry AƱos and Myrna Pitaluna. PSEFI was led by Dr. Maritess H. Requina, Executive Director, and Engr. Steve Y. Banzon, Technical Training Director, together with 13 volunteers from PSEFI-SKILLS: Sir Bobby Cabangon (Academics), Sir Rene Arcenas and Sir Marben Manabat (Technical Trainers), Rhea (Registrar), Mayline (Documentation-Cooperative-in-Charge), Jackie, Danielle and Denesse (Accounting Staff), Grace (Support Staff) June (Librarian), Annaliza, Marison, Angeila (Senior HS Staff).
